Lore and further backstory/plot are to be provided if this ends up turning into a RP but basically the bones are as follows:

A small fishing town nestled in the quiet wilderness caressing the majestic peaks of the black ridge mountains has roots that date back to the town's founding centuries before. However, with a population under five thousand, this isn't a town you move to, it's one you move away from in search of anything more than mundane routine and well, fishing. One good thing about it however is the fact that the original families in this town are tight knit and have formed a very close, safe community in which the youth can galavant about without worry of running into dangers. Everyone looks out for each other and are no strangers to extending a helping hand or initiating group gatherings as often as desired. The elders of this quaint village are well diversed in the rich (and rather controversial) history of the beloved community and will take any opportunity to tell their stories and bestow knowledge on the next generations. The only problem is … many of the stories contain elements of the supernatural that lead many to believe that maybe there is something in the water that gets into your head after so many years. I mean come on, vampires? Magical shape shifting tribes people? No way. It’s definitely hard to believe until the first of them shifts for the very first time out of the blue. If the stories are correct, then that means there is a new threat challenging to destroy the very existence of this quiet little town and everyone in it. The shifters must quickly learn how to control their new abilities, learn to get along in their new order, and strengthen themselves in order to take on this new enemy ... if they can even find it first.
